Under the guidance of his Italian-native mother, and heavily influenced by his travels throughout Italy, Jake Imperiale opened Bella Napoli in 2001 to meet Kansas City’s need for authentic Italian food, wine and market goods. Jake hand selects each product for Bella’s deli and market and every item is imported from Italy. Wander across the room and you’ll be immersed in an atmosphere as authentically Italian as it gets. An integral element of Bella Napoli, the pizzeria offers a variety of traditional Italian dishes.
